Preparing for the Wash

Before you start washing your Toyota Highlander, there are a few things you need to prepare. First and foremost, you'll need some basic car washing supplies. These include a car wash soap, a large sponge or car wash mitt, a bucket, and a hose with a spray nozzle.

It's also a good idea to have a few microfiber towels on hand for drying your car after the wash. Microfiber towels are excellent for this purpose as they are super absorbent and gentle on your car's paintwork.

Choosing the Right Time and Place

When it comes to washing your car, timing and location are crucial. It's best to wash your car on a cool, cloudy day as direct sunlight can cause the soap to dry too quickly, leading to streaks and spots. If you can't avoid washing your car in the sun, try to do it early in the morning or late in the afternoon when the sun is less intense.

As for the location, choose a spot that's far away from the road to avoid dust and dirt from getting onto your freshly washed car. Also, make sure that you're not washing your car over grass or plants as the soap can harm them.

Washing Your Toyota Highlander

Now that you're all set, it's time to get down to the business of washing your Highlander. Start by rinsing your car with a hose to remove loose dirt and debris. This step is important as it prevents you from scratching your car's paintwork when you start scrubbing.

Next, fill your bucket with water and add the recommended amount of car wash soap. Dip your sponge or car wash mitt into the soapy water and start washing your car from the top down. This method ensures that the dirt and soap suds flow downward, making your job easier.

Rinsing and Drying

Once you've washed every part of your car, it's time to rinse it off. Again, start from the top and work your way down. Make sure to rinse thoroughly to remove all the soap suds as they can leave spots if left to dry on the car.

After rinsing, use your microfiber towels to dry your car. Drying is an important step as it prevents water spots from forming on your car's paintwork. Plus, it gives your car that nice, shiny finish that we all love.

Additional Tips for Washing Your Toyota Highlander

While the steps above will help you wash your Highlander effectively, there are a few additional tips that can make the process even smoother. For instance, it's a good idea to wash your wheels and tires first. These areas tend to be the dirtiest and washing them first prevents the dirt from splashing onto your clean car later.

Also, remember to clean the inside of your car as well. Vacuum the interior, wipe down the dashboard and other surfaces, and clean the windows for a complete car wash experience.

Protecting Your Car's Paintwork

Lastly, consider applying a coat of wax or paint sealant after washing your car. These products provide a protective layer on your car's paintwork, helping to keep it looking shiny and new. They also make it easier to wash your car in the future as they prevent dirt and grime from sticking to the paint.
